Where Exactly Is Portugal? A Simple Map Explanation
Imagine a straightforward map of Europe: Portugal appears at the southwestern corner, nestled between Spain to the east and the vast Atlantic Ocean to the west and south. More precisely, Portugal’s territory includes the Iberian Peninsula—sharing a border with Spain—and stretches across the Atlantic via its archipelagos like the Azores and Madeira, which are Portuguese territories but geographically positioned far from mainland Europe.

Why This Map Matters: Understanding Portugal’s European Identity
Despite its oceanic separation from most of continental Europe, Portugal is undeniably part of the continent—geographically, politically, and culturally. The simple map above helps illustrate that Portugal straddles two realms: firmly rooted in Europe’s western peninsula yet uniquely connected to the wider Atlantic world.
This geographic duality explains Portugal’s distinct historical evolution—from ancient Celtic influences, Moorish rule, Iberian union with Spain, to its modern role as a coastal European Union member democracy.
